Resumen

Introducción/objetivo: tal como en el resto del mundo, en Latinoamérica existe una alta prevalencia de violencia interpersonal en la infancia y adolescencia que se asocia a consecuencias psicológicas a corto, mediano y largo plazo. Internacionalmente se ha avanzado en el reconocimiento de psicoterapias basadas en la evidencia, pero se desconoce la situación de Latinoamérica. El objetivo de esta revisión sistemática es identificar cuales modelos o modalidades de psicoterapia han mostrado efectividad en Latinoamérica. Método: se realizó una búsqueda sistemática en cinco bases de datos con términos de búsqueda relacionados con intervenciones psicosociales para personas expuestos a violencia interpersonal en la infancia en Latinoamérica. Se excluyeron los estudios sobre poblaciones latinas radicadas en Estados Unidos. Resultados: se reconocieron 13 intervenciones y un estudio de seguimiento en los que se evalúa la efectividad de distintos modelos (cognitivo conductuales y con influencia psicodinámica). Aunque en todos ellos se muestran cambios clínica o estadísticamente significativos en sintomatología de estrés postraumático, ansiedad y depresión, en su gran mayoría se trata de estudios piloto con importantes limitaciones metodológicas. Conclusiones: se considera necesario avanzar en la elaboración de estudios más robustos (ej. ensayos clínicos controlados y aleatorizados) que otorguen evidencia más sólida de la efectividad de las intervenciones en el contexto cultural latinoamericano.

Abstract

Introduction/Objective: As in the rest of the world, in Latin America there is a high prevalence of interpersonal violence (IV) in childhood and adolescence, which is associated with psychological consequences in the short, medium and long term. At the international level, progress has been made in the recognition of evidence-based psychotherapies, but the situation in Latin America is unknown. The objective of this systematic literature review is to identify which psychotherapy models or modalities have been shown to be effective in Latin America. Methods: A systematic search of five databases was carried out with search terms relating to psychosocial interventions of people exposed to IV during childhood, based in Latin America. Studies regarding Latino populations based in United States were excluded. Results: 14 papers describing 13 studies and one follow-up were identified. Individual and group interventions (mainly cognitive-behavioural and with psychodynamic influence) were included. Although all showed clinically or statistically significant changes in symptoms of post-traumatic stress, anxiety and depression, most were pilot studies with important methodological limitations and a high risk of bias. Conclusions: It is necessary to develop clinical practice in Latin America with more robust research (i.e., controlled and randomised clinical trials) that produce more reliable evidence regarding the effectiveness of psychosocial interventions for IV involving children and adolescents in the Latin American context.
